Hess Corporation Company Shares Owned By Insiders Analysis

Hess' Shares Owned by Insiders show the percentage of outstanding shares owned by insiders (such as principal officers or members of the board of directors) or private individuals and entities with over 5% of the total shares outstanding. Company executives or private individuals with access to insider information share information about a firm's operations that is not available to the general public.

Competition

Based on the latest financial disclosure, 9.47599999999999% of Hess Corporation are shares owned by insiders. This is 12.18% lower than that of the Oil, Gas & Consumable Fuels sector and 13.3% lower than that of the Energy industry. The shares owned by insiders for all United States stocks is 6.09% higher than that of the company.

The market value of Hess is measured differently than its book value, which is the value of Hess that is recorded on the company's balance sheet. Investors also form their own opinion of Hess' value that differs from its market value or its book value, called intrinsic value, which is Hess' true underlying value. Investors use various methods to calculate intrinsic value and buy a stock when its market value falls below its intrinsic value. Because Hess' market value can be influenced by many factors that don't directly affect Hess' underlying business (such as a pandemic or basic market pessimism), market value can vary widely from intrinsic value.
Please note, there is a significant difference between Hess' value and its price as these two are different measures arrived at by different means. Investors typically determine if Hess is a good investment by looking at such factors as earnings, sales, fundamental and technical indicators, competition as well as analyst projections. However, Hess' price is the amount at which it trades on the open market and represents the number that a seller and buyer find agreeable to each party.
